Responsibilities
• Responsible for maintaining the procedures and instructions within the department.
• Develop an annual maintenance plan, ensure proper completion of scheduling of major plant projects, plant shutdown maintenance program, quoting of estimated hours of downtime required for repairing breakdowns, and provide necessary updates to facility management.
• Ensures procedures are in place to properly expedite lead-time items with suppliers and responsible for an inventory control system with maximum and minimum limits for all plant equipment.
• Oversee the implementation of ongoing and preventative maintenance
• Authorizes all maintenance-related purchase orders.
• Responsible for the scheduling and assigning of daily duties of all employees in the department and reviews completed work for conformance to standards and to ensure production is on schedule.
• Recommends outside contractors as required. Ensure compliance of all maintenance personnel in regard to the scheduling of outside contractors within the Company guidelines.
• Responsible for maintaining safe working conditions and practices to ensure the safety of the employees. Ensures that all employees know how to perform each job efficiently assigned to them and that they are fully aware of the correct and safe way to operate their equipment. Ensures that all employees are instructed on the use and compliance with Company standards on the use of personal protective equipment.
• Ensures that a proper investigation of any accident is completed and reported promptly.
• Performs workplace inspections.
• Orders parts for repair and maintenance purposes.
• Correcting substandard acts or conditions.
• Conducting information sessions (safety talks, staff meetings, tailgate meetings) incident
Qualifications
• Industrial Millwright/Mechanic trade certification, Industrial Electrician trade certification, Tool and Die trade certification, Controls Automation certification or a solid background in industrial maintenance involving electrical, hydraulic and mechanical processes would be an asset.
• Ideally have three or more years related supervisory experience in a manufacturing environment
• Excellent leadership, interpersonal and communication skills.
• Ability to operate PC (Microsoft) based and other manufacturing related software.
• Knowledge of Health & Safety Legislation and experience in administering collective agreements would be an asset.
• Familiar with automatic production equipment, robotics, PLC’s, assembly welding and press shop operations would be an asset.
